### Dashboard user recipient convention
|
||||
|
||||
For dashboard user messaging, agents should target the canonical user recipient ID `dashboard`.
|
||||
|
||||
Runtime safeguards defensively normalize the legacy alias forms below to the same logical dashboard user:
|
||||
- `dashboard` (canonical)
|
||||
- `user:dashboard`
|
||||
- `User: user:dashboard`
|
||||
|
||||
This normalization applies on send and mailbox reads, so replies from agents still land in the dashboard inbox even when older alias-like recipient strings appear.
